Crime Prevention Breakfast

Our Director, Michael Paille, recently had the opportunity to attend the Crime Prevention Breakfast. Chief Gene Bowers’ reflections on his nine months as Chief, particularly the focus on community safety pillars, resonated strongly. Events like these highlight the crucial collaboration needed between the Winnipeg Police Service, the business sector, and community stakeholders to enhance safety in our neighbourhood and city.

Here is a post from Winnipeg Police Service Facebook page talking about the event:

“Whereas… (if you know, you know).

Chief Gene Bowers had the privilege of addressing a packed room at the 2025 Manitoba Criminal Justice Association Crime Prevention Breakfast. Stakeholders from across the criminal justice community came together for this annual event which has become a long-standing highlight of Crime Prevention Month in Manitoba.

This year’s breakfast also fell on the anniversary of Chief Bowers’ 36th year of service with the Winnipeg Police Service. He shared reflections on the pillars that have guided his first nine months as Chief and how they continue to shape our collective approach to community safety.

Following the keynote, Sheila North, author and Indigenous Advisor to the Winnipeg Police Service, moderated a panel discussion featuring Chief Bowers, Inspector Helen Peters (Divisional Commander, Central Division), and Greg Burnett (Executive Director, Downtown Community Safety Partnership).

Thank you to everyone who joined us this morning as well as your continued partnership, collaboration, and commitment to safety in our city.”
